✅ The 16 Bible Verses About End Times (With Encouraging, Faith-Building Commentaries)

Scripture encourages watchfulness without fear, calling hearts to hope, perseverance, and confident trust in God’s promises.
These Bible verses about end times remind believers that God remains sovereign, faithful, and in control of history’s future.
1. God Holds the Future Securely
“I am the Alpha and the Omega,” says the Lord God, “who is, and who was, and who is to come, the Almighty.” (Revelation 1:8)
Commentary 1: God stands at the beginning and the end of all things. Knowing this brings peace when thinking about the future.
Commentary 2: Nothing unfolds outside God’s authority. His power secures every moment ahead.
2. Jesus Will Return
“This same Jesus, who has been taken from you into heaven, will come back in the same way you have seen him go.” (Acts 1:11)
Commentary 1: Jesus’ return is a promise, not a possibility. Believers can live with hopeful expectation.
Commentary 2: His return brings restoration and justice. Hope grows when faith looks forward.
3. The End Is Known by God Alone
“But about that day or hour no one knows, not even the angels in heaven, nor the Son, but only the Father.” (Matthew 24:36)
Commentary 1: God alone knows the timing of the end. This truth encourages trust rather than anxiety.
Commentary 2: Believers are called to readiness, not fear. Faith rests in God’s wisdom.
4. God Calls Believers to Be Watchful
“Therefore keep watch, because you do not know on what day your Lord will come.” (Matthew 24:42)
Commentary 1: Watchfulness means living faithfully every day. God values steady obedience.
Commentary 2: Being prepared brings peace and confidence. Faith stays alert and hopeful.
5. God’s Kingdom Will Prevail
“The kingdom of the world has become the kingdom of our Lord and of his Messiah, and he will reign forever and ever.” (Revelation 11:15)
Commentary 1: God’s kingdom will ultimately triumph. No power can overthrow His reign.
Commentary 2: This promise strengthens hope during uncertainty. God’s rule is eternal.
6. God Gives Peace in Troubling Times
“See to it that you are not alarmed. Such things must happen, but the end is still to come.” (Matthew 24:6)
Commentary 1: God acknowledges troubling events but calls believers to remain calm. Fear is not from Him.
Commentary 2: Peace comes from trusting God’s plan. His purposes continue even in chaos.
7. God Promises Salvation at the End
“But the one who stands firm to the end will be saved.” (Matthew 24:13)
Commentary 1: Endurance reflects genuine faith. God honors perseverance with salvation.
Commentary 2: Standing firm brings assurance. God strengthens believers to endure faithfully.
8. God Will Judge With Justice
“For he has set a day when he will judge the world with justice.” (Acts 17:31)
Commentary 1: God’s judgment is fair and righteous. Justice will ultimately prevail.
Commentary 2: This brings comfort to those seeking righteousness. God’s justice restores order.
9. God Calls Believers to Holy Living
“What kind of people ought you to be? You ought to live holy and godly lives.” (2 Peter 3:11)
Commentary 1: End times awareness shapes daily living. God calls His people to holiness.
Commentary 2: Holy living reflects trust in God’s future. Faith expresses itself through obedience.
10. God Delays for Mercy
“The Lord is not slow in keeping his promise… but is patient with you, not wanting anyone to perish.” (2 Peter 3:9)
Commentary 1: God’s patience reflects His mercy and love. He desires repentance and salvation.
Commentary 2: This truth reveals God’s compassionate heart. Hope remains open to all.
11. God Will Renew Creation
“Then I saw a new heaven and a new earth.” (Revelation 21:1)
Commentary 1: God’s plan ends with renewal, not destruction. New life awaits creation.
Commentary 2: This promise brings hope beyond suffering. God restores all things.
12. God Will Remove Suffering Forever
“There will be no more death or mourning or crying or pain.” (Revelation 21:4)
Commentary 1: The end times bring an end to suffering. God wipes away every tear.
Commentary 2: Eternal peace replaces pain. God’s future is filled with comfort and joy.
13. God’s Word Will Stand Forever
“Heaven and earth will pass away, but my words will never pass away.” (Matthew 24:35)
Commentary 1: God’s Word remains unshaken through all change. His truth is eternal.
Commentary 2: Trusting Scripture brings stability. God’s promises endure forever.
14. God Calls Believers to Faithful Service
“Blessed is that servant whom his master finds doing so when he returns.” (Matthew 24:46)
Commentary 1: Faithful service matters until Christ returns. God values consistency.
Commentary 2: Serving with faith brings blessing. Hope fuels faithful living.
15. God Promises Victory Over Evil
“The God of peace will soon crush Satan under your feet.” (Romans 16:20)
Commentary 1: Evil will not prevail forever. God promises final victory.
Commentary 2: This truth builds confidence. God’s peace triumphs completely.
16. God Calls Believers to Hope
“Yes, I am coming soon.” Amen. Come, Lord Jesus. (Revelation 22:20)
Commentary 1: The Bible ends with hope-filled anticipation. Jesus’ return is good news.
Commentary 2: Hope anchors faith in uncertain times. God’s promise brings joyful expectation.
